What companies run services between London Eye, England and Primrose Hill, Greater London, England?

London Underground (Tube) operates a subway from Embankment station to Chalk Farm station every 5 minutes. Tickets cost £3–11 and the journey takes 13 min. Alternatively, Abellio London operates a bus from Westminster Station / Parliament Square to Ferdinand Street every 10 minutes. Tickets cost £2 and the journey takes 31 min.
